Meet Augustus aka Gus Gus

Meet Augustus, who goes by Gus Gus, an adorable three-month-old shepherd pup ready to steal your heart! Gus Gus has been a lovely addition to his foster home, where he lives in a bustling household with the resident dog he snuggles and learns from, three resident cats, two birds, and a doting teenager. Gus Gus is not only a smart pup but also a well-socialized one. He has been exposed to various experiences, including car rides and outings, which have helped him become comfortable in different environments. He's even had some pup cups to add fun to his life! Gus Gus loves his visits to Petco for treats and new harnesses, as he's been growing by leaps in the last three weeks. He has also been meeting little people and has even hung out in the family's RV in case his potential forever family likes to camp to get him used to new experiences. As all puppies do, Gus is currently going through his teething phase. He has an assortment of bones and chew toys to help him redirect his chewing behavior onto appropriate items. He's also losing some baby teeth and gaining his adult teeth right on schedule. He loves snuggling for TV time and enjoys watching Dr. Pol and other shows attentive for his young age. A quick learner and a pleaser, Gus Gus is learning the art of sitting, down, and other skills thanks to his fosters and his love of treats. His potty skills are on point, too, which will make him a paw-some addition to a family skilled at German Shepherds or similar breeds committed to raising a puppy to neutral adult dogs. Raising shepherd puppies requires a commitment to structure, training, and environmental exposures, along with lots of time. Gus Gus arrived from the shelter with his three littermates, Archie, Arlo, and Zeux. They were on the euthanasia list five days after clearing their mandated hold period due to space. We are so grateful to our community for saying yes to save their lives. Adoption Process
$400 puppies 12 months and under, $350 for 1-6 year olds, $200 for 7 and older. We have a comprehensive adoption application and do home visits approving adopters for levels of dogs and puppies. We have adoption agreements requiring return of dog to us for any reason.
